Dolf Boerman is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Dolf Boerman has authored 5 papers receiving a total of 313 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health, 2 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 2 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Dolf Boerman’s work include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ers), Cancer-related cognitive impairment studies (1 paper) and Lysosomal Storage Disorders Research (1 paper). Dolf Boerman is often cited by papers focused on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ers), Cancer-related cognitive impairment studies (1 paper) and Lysosomal Storage Disorders Research (1 paper). Dolf Boerman collaborates with scholars based in The Netherlands and United States. Dolf Boerman's co-authors include Martin J. van den Bent, Theo Veninga, Martin Klein, Willem Boogerd, A. Twijnstra, Chad M. Gundy, A.C. Kappelle, Margriet M. Sitskoorn, Martin Klein and Sietske A.M. Sikkes and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, PLoS ONE and Neurology.
